Why Consider Storage in Bed?
Beds serve not only as a place to sleep but also as a multifunctional hub of daily life. Laptops, books, gym gear, winter coats, and seasonal decor often clutter the floor or pile beside the bed—creating chaos and making your space feel smaller. Incorporating storage directly into or near your bed helps:
- Free up floor space for movement and comfort
- Reduce visual clutter for a calming ambiance
- Improve accessibility to everyday items
- Extend storage capacity without extra square footage
- Protect and preserve clothes, linens, and electronics

Popular Types of Bed Storage Solutions
1. Under-Bed Storage Cabinets
One of the most effective ways to utilize vertical space is with depth-adjustable under-bed drawers and cabinets. Many systems feature lockable, transparent pull-out drawers that store bikes, off-season clothing, blankets, or luggage—keeping them protected and hidden.
2. Bed Frames with Built-in Storage
Modern bed frames come equipped with integrated storage like hanging rods for outerwear, tiered drawers for drawers and accessories, or even fold-down desks beneath the mattress. These designs merge sleeping and storage seamlessly.
3. Bedding Organizers and Drawers
Pull-out linen drawers, fabric bins, and under-bed storage pockets keep your sheets, pillowcases, and clothes neatly tucked away yet easily accessible. These are ideal for those who want a clutter-free surface without sacrificing comfort.

4. Wall-Mounted Storage Near Beds
Floating shelves, leaning ladders, or wall-mounted cabinets free up floor space and keep frequently used items—like books, lamps, or tech accessories—within easy reach.

Tips for Optimizing Bed Storage
- Choose scale-appropriate furniture: Ensure storage pieces fit your bed size—oversized cabinets may overwhelm a small space.
- Use vertical space: Stackable bins and tall drawers maximize height without demanding extra floor area.
- Organize by frequency of use: Keep daily essentials within arm’s reach, while seasonal or infrequently used items go in deeper storage.
- Incorporate locking mechanisms: Secure valuable items like laptops or electronics with pedaled drawers or combination locks.
- Maintain aesthetics: Match storage colors to your room’s palette and keep accessories tidy for a sleek, inviting look.
